Breakfast Menu And Prices
Breakfast is served all day at most locations, which is great for those who like pancakes at noon. The breakfast menu is split into hot scramblers, sweet options, and lighter fare. Here is what you can expect to pay:
- Bacon & Cheddar Scrambler – $9.99
- Garden Scrambler – $9.49
- Ham & Swiss Scrambler – $9.99
- Steel Cut Oatmeal (with toppings) – $6.29
- Fresh Fruit & Yogurt Parfait – $5.99
- Breakfast Sandwich on Croissant – $7.49
- Egg & Cheese on Bagel – $6.49
You can add a side of fresh fruit or a muffin to any breakfast item for about $2.50 extra. The scramblers come with two eggs, cheese, and your choice of protein, plus a side of their signature toast. If you are really hungry, the “Big Scrambler” option with double meat runs about $12.49.
Sandwiches And Paninis
Lunch is where Kneaders really shines. They use their freshly baked bread for every sandwich, and the portions are generous. The sandwiches are served with a pickle spear and your choice of a side. Here are the popular picks and their prices:
- Turkey Avocado Sandwich – $10.99
- Chicken Caesar Wrap – $9.79
- Ham & Swiss on Sourdough – $9.49
- Club Sandwich (Triple Decker) – $11.49
- Grilled Cheese (Artisan) – $7.99
- Turkey Bacon Club Panini – $10.99
- Roast Beef & Cheddar – $11.29
You can upgrade your side from chips to a cup of soup or a small salad for an additional $2.99. The “Half Sandwich” option is available for those who want a lighter meal, and it usually costs about $6.49. That is a good way to save money if you aren’t starving.

Soups And Chili
Kneaders serves soup in a bread bowl, which is honestly the best way to eat soup. The soup selection rotates daily, but the classics are always available. Here is the pricing structure for soups:
- Cup of Soup – $4.99
- Bowl of Soup – $6.49
- Bread Bowl with Soup – $8.99
- Chili (Cup) – $5.49
- Chili (Bread Bowl) – $9.49
The most popular soup is the Broccoli Cheddar, followed closely by the Tomato Basil. If you pair a cup of soup with a half sandwich, you will pay around $8.99 for the combo. That is one of the best value deals on the entire menu.
Pastries And Baked Goods
You cannot go to Kneaders without looking at the pastry case. They are famous for their huge cinnamon rolls and fruit tarts. The baked goods are made fresh every morning, and they often sell out by the afternoon. Here are the prices:
- Signature Cinnamon Roll – $4.29
- Chocolate Croissant – $3.99
- Butter Croissant – $3.49
- Fruit Tart (Individual) – $4.99
- Danish (Cheese or Fruit) – $3.79
- Muffin (Seasonal) – $3.29
- Cookie (Giant) – $2.99
The cinnamon roll is massive, so you could easily share it with a friend. They also sell “day-old” bread and pastries at a discount of about 50% off, but you have to ask for those specifically. The day-old items are usually available after 5 PM.

Catering And Bulk Orders
If you are planning a party or a work event, Kneaders catering is a great option. They offer boxed lunches, sandwich trays, and dessert platters. Catering prices are usually quoted per person, and the minimum order is for 10 people. Here is a rough guide:
- Boxed Lunch (Sandwich, Cookie, Chips) – $12.99 per person
- Sandwich Tray (Assorted, serves 10) – $64.99
- Pastry Tray (serves 12) – $39.99
- Cookie Platter (dozen) – $21.99
- Soup & Salad Bar (per person) – $14.99
You need to place catering orders at least 24 hours in advance. They will provide disposable serving utensils and napkins at no extra cost. For large orders, it is best to call the store directly rather than ordering online.

Nutritional Information And Allergens
If you have dietary restrictions, you should know that Kneaders provides a full allergen menu online. They do not use peanut oil, but there is a risk of cross-contamination with nuts in the bakery. The breads contain gluten, obviously, but they do offer a gluten-free bread option for an extra $1.50 on sandwiches.
Most of the salads can be made vegan by removing the cheese and chicken. The soups are not gluten-free due to the flour used as a thickener. You can ask for a nutrition pamphlet at the counter, but the most up-to-date info is on their official website.
